					Originally Posted by Butch7999  A more fluent speaker can provide a better translation than an on-line programme, but it's something like this:  
 Schmeling and Babe Ruth
 The baseball unknown with us is the popular sportsman, the baseball king
 beyond the ocean, who enjoys annually 100,000 dollars, as large an income
 as the President of the United States. Here Max Schmeling admires Babe Ruth
 at a baseball game in Ohio; of course the photographers have given us this
 "historical" event.
 
 Bulgaria Sport
 3 1/3 Pfg.-Cigarette
 Album RM.1. - in the cigarettes-store or by stamps
 directly through Bulgaria Cigarettes-factory, Dresden A.21
